10 Ruled out and three doubts – Manchester United vs Sevilla injury news – Europa League Quarter-final

Manchester United will host Sevilla in the opening leg of their Europa League quarter-final on Thursday night at Old Trafford.

The Red Devils will enter the game fresh off a 2-0 Premier League win over Everton on Saturday afternoon, which reinforced their hold on a top-four spot in the table.

Erik ten Hag’s team will now try to clinch a first-leg advantage in Manchester ahead of the rematch against Sevilla next week.

Sports Mole brings you the latest injury and suspension news for Manchester United ahead of their match against Sevilla, who eliminated Fenerbahce in the last round of the Europa League.

Marcus Rashford is a serious doubt for the first leg of the last-eight tie due to a groin injury suffered late in Saturday’s match against Everton.

Luke Shaw missed Saturday’s game against Everton due to a hamstring injury suffered against Brentford, and he is a significant doubt for the European match.

Donny van de Beek’s season was cut short after he sustained a significant knee injury in January, with the Netherlands international working hard to be ready for pre-season.

Alejandro Garnacho suffered an ankle injury in the previous draw with Southampton and will miss this game as well, but he is expected to return in the coming weeks.

Tom Heaton, Manchester United’s number two goalkeeper, is still out with an ankle injury sustained during a recent training session.
